
Tri-Cities’ Country Singer, Kate Turner, Drops Long-Awaited EP “Men Like You”
Who is Kate Turner?
Originally from Burbank, Washington, Kate Turner experienced huge success in 2011 with her song “Baby No”. She was on a roll and recognized as an upcoming star in the country music industry - working with and opening for some of the biggest names at that time - Tim McGraw, Gretchen Wilson, and Sawyer Brown. However, after facing challenges as a young woman in the music industry, including sexual harassment and other pressures, she gave up her singing career and decided to focus on her family.

As reported by Tumbleweird.com earlier this month, Kate Turner is back with a new EP, and although she’s known for her work in jazz and R&B, Kate’s new release stays true to her roots - country.
The “Men Like You” title track is traditional and features local Grammy-winning bluegrass player, Joe Smart. From the first note, you can hear the influences of one of her inspirations, country legend, Hank Williams. True country fans will eat it up!
With “Men Like You” and an upcoming jazz/R&B album in the works, Kate is blazing back into the spotlight. She told Tumbleweird.com, “This is me finishing something I started 20 years ago.”
Kate Turner is back on the road
Those familiar with Kate Turner and her music are celebrating her return to the stage–and she’s been busy - performing throughout Washington and Oregon over the winter. She recently partnered with Big Nose Kate Western Whiskey as a brand ambassador which comes with a sponsorship for her upcoming regional tour set for early fall of 2025. The brand and Big Nose Kate were built around "the story of a fiercely brave and independent woman, Kate Horoney", which perfectly aligns with Turner's comeback.
